Boxwood Planting in Ventura County, CA

Boxwood planting services involve the careful installation of these popular evergreen shrubs to enhance the aesthetic appeal and structure of residential landscapes. Property owners often request these services for creating formal hedges, defining garden borders, or adding year-round greenery to their yards. The process typically includes selecting healthy plants, preparing the planting site, and ensuring proper spacing and soil conditions to promote healthy growth. Homeowners usually want to understand the best planting practices, suitable varieties for their climate, and maintenance requirements to ensure their new boxwoods thrive over time.

Before requesting boxwood planting services, property owners should consider factors such as the available space, sunlight exposure, and soil quality in the intended planting area. It’s also helpful to determine the desired height and shape of the shrubs, as well as any specific landscape design goals. Understanding these details can assist in choosing the right type of boxwood and planning for ongoing care. Proper planning and professional installation can contribute to a lush, attractive landscape feature that complements the overall outdoor environment.

FAQ

Boxwood Planting Questions

What is involved in planting boxwoods? Planting boxwoods includes preparing the soil, selecting healthy plants, and properly placing and spacing them for growth.

What types of boxwoods are suitable for planting? Common options include English, Japanese, and American boxwoods, chosen based on the desired size and landscape style.

How should boxwoods be cared for after planting? Regular watering, mulching, and occasional pruning help maintain healthy and attractive boxwoods.

Can boxwoods be planted in any season? Boxwoods can be planted in most seasons, but early spring or fall are typically ideal for establishing new plants.
